Many people think of fertility as being a woman’s problem, but in about half of couples who are experiencing infertility, a male factor can be the issue. Healthy Weight Loss for Fertility
As women, weight can affect our ability to conceive. BMI (body mass index) is an indirect measure of body fat calculated by dividing your weight (in kilograms) by your height (in meters). Five Ways Your Thyroid Can Affect Fertility
Your thyroid is a small butterfly-shaped gland that’s located at the front of your neck. Despite being small, your thyroid has a large impact on many—if not all—of your body’s systems.
